2. Chauffeur Theory Test
The very first practical step in obtaining a driving license is passing the theory test, known as the Code comment acheter un permis de conduire Français la Route. This test evaluates prospects on their knowledge of road signs, traffic guidelines, and safe driving practices. The multiple-choice format includes 40 questions, needing a minimum of 35 appropriate answers to pass.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How long does it take to get a driving license in France?
The period varies depending on private circumstances. Normally, the procedure varies from a few months to a year, affected by the availability of tests and lessons.
2. Is it possible to transform a foreign driving license to a French one?
Yes, EU and EFTA license holders can convert their licenses with no tests. Non-EU nationals might need to take the test, depending upon their native land's contracts with France.
3. What if I stop working the useful driving test?
Prospects can retake the test. However, they may need to have a particular number of additional lessons before being permitted to reattempt.

5. What are the costs associated with obtaining a license?
Overall expenses can range between EUR1,200 and EUR2,000, depending on the selected driving school, variety of lessons required, and test costs.
